Automatic music transcription is the process of converting an audio recording into a symbolic representation using musical notation. It has numerous applications in music information retrieval, computational musicology, and the creation of interactive systems. This article gives a presentation of the Automatic Gain Control algorithm used in WCDMA (3rd generation mobile networks). The focus is on how the controller bandwidth influences settling times and modulation distortion. This will be investigated through simulation for two different channel cases.

In this paper, we propose to use speech modulation features for robust nonnative accent detection. Modulation spectrum carries long term temporal information of speech and may discriminate accents of native and nonnative speakers. In a non-cooperative communication environment, automatic modulation classification (AMC) is an essential technology for analyzing signals and classifying different kinds of signal before they are demodulated.
